Step 1: Understand RTP and Game Variants
Before placing your bets, familiarize yourself with the RTP of different Keno games. The RTP can vary significantly, typically ranging from 75% to 95%. Higher RTP percentages mean better odds for players. Here’s a breakdown of typical RTP values for common Keno variants:
| Game Variant | RTP (%) |
|---|---|
| Standard Keno | 75-80% |
| Power Keno | 80-85% |
| Progressive Keno | 85-90% |
| Live Keno | 90-95% |
Choosing a game with a higher RTP maximizes your potential returns. For example, opting for a Live Keno game could provide an RTP of up to 95%, which is more advantageous than a Standard Keno game at 75%.
